Kholodny Institute of Botany NASU popup.description2 Results of researches of embryo differentiation of the Brassica rapa and accumulations of reserve nutrient substrances in the cells of integuments and embryo cotyledons, when plants were cultivated on an artificial basalt microfibrous substratum under clinorotation with goal of strengthening of plant viability and thus to prevent of disturbances in generative development, are presented. Significant similarity of rate in embryo developmtnt under altered gravity and in laboratory control is revealed, but different cases of the infringements in process differentiation of the cotyledons and radicle at different stages of embryo formation are noted. The cases of deviations in accumulation of reserve nutrient substance in thr cells of the integuments and the cotyledons of embryo of B. rapa plants, which developed in altered gravity in comparison with the control, are establish also. Data received during comparative analysis of the experiment results, when B.rapa plants cultivated on different substrates under clinorotation, testify, that not the conditions of plant cultivation, but the changed gravitation serves as reason of rejections in embryogenesis of plants. Cytoembryological analysis of embryo development under clinorotation and in microgravity has shown, that infringements of embryo differentiation and deviations in accumulation of reserve nutrient substances can be one of principal causes of formation in these conditions of the seed, which by biometric characteristics differ from those of control variants.
